Ottawa, April 15, 2025: Federal party leaders will square off this week in back-to-back French and English debates, marking a decisive moment in the 2025 election campaign as advanced polls open in just days.Liberal Leader Mark Carney, Conservative Leader Pierre Poilievre, NDP’s Jagmeet Singh, Bloc Quebecois Leader Yves-François Blanchet, and Green Party co-leader Jonathan Pedneault are all set to participate after meeting the criteria laid out by the federal debates commission.
